1. Bold Text
Entry path: Edit in the lower-right corner → Aa at the bottom → Text Styles → Bold
- Open a smart document and tap Edit in the lower-right corner.
- Tap the paragraph you want to change, or select the target text.
- Tap Aa in the bottom toolbar.
- Tap Bold in the text style area.
Success Criteria
- Visual result: the selected text appears with a heavier weight.
- Next action available: you can continue typing or apply more text styles.
Tips While Using
- Common mistake: if you are not in editing mode, the bottom style panel does not appear.

5. Change Font Color
Entry path: Edit in the lower-right corner → Aa at the bottom → Font Color area
- Open a smart document and tap Edit.
- Tap the paragraph you want to change, or select the target text.
- Tap Aa at the bottom.
- Choose a color in the Font Color area.
Success Criteria
- Visual result: the target text changes to the selected color.
- Next action available: you can switch colors again or combine color with bold and other styles.
Tips While Using
- Common mistake: font color and highlight color are separate settings.
6. Change Highlight Color
Entry path: Edit in the lower-right corner → Aa at the bottom → Highlight Color area
- Open a smart document and tap Edit.
- Tap the paragraph you want to change, or select the target text.
- Tap Aa at the bottom.
- Choose a color in the Highlight Color area.
Success Criteria
- Visual result: the background behind the target text changes to the selected highlight color.
- Next action available: you can continue review marking or collaborative annotation.
Tips While Using
- Common mistake: highlight color changes the text background, not the text color itself.
